    """Inner train routine.

    Parameters
    ----------
417
418
    client : dask.distributed.Client
        Dask client.
419
    data : Dask Array or Dask DataFrame of shape = [n_samples, n_features]
420
        Input feature matrix.
421
    label : Dask Array, Dask DataFrame or Dask Series of shape = [n_samples]
422
423
        The target values (class labels in classification, real numbers in regression).
    params : dict
424
        Parameters passed to constructor of the local underlying model.
425
    model_factory : lightgbm.LGBMClassifier, lightgbm.LGBMRegressor, or lightgbm.LGBMRanker class
426
        Class of the local underlying model.
427
    sample_weight : Dask Array or Dask Series of shape = [n_samples] or None, optional (default=None)
428
        Weights of training data. Weights should be non-negative.
429
    init_score : Dask Array or Dask Series of shape = [n_samples] or shape = [n_samples * n_classes] (for multi-class task), or Dask Array or Dask DataFrame of shape = [n_samples, n_classes] (for multi-class task), or None, optional (default=None)
430
        Init score of training data.
431
    group : Dask Array or Dask Series or None, optional (default=None)
432
433
434
435
436
        Group/query data.
        Only used in the learning-to-rank task.
        sum(group) = n_samples.
        For example, if you have a 100-document dataset with ``group = [10, 20, 40, 10, 10, 10]``, that means that you have 6 groups,
        where the first 10 records are in the first group, records 11-30 are in the second group, records 31-70 are in the third group, etc.
437
    eval_set : list of (X, y) tuples of Dask data collections, or None, optional (default=None)
438
439
440
441
        List of (X, y) tuple pairs to use as validation sets.
        Note, that not all workers may receive chunks of every eval set within ``eval_set``. When the returned
        lightgbm estimator is not trained using any chunks of a particular eval set, its corresponding component
        of evals_result_ and best_score_ will be 'not_evaluated'.
442
    eval_names : list of str, or None, optional (default=None)
443
        Names of eval_set.
444
    eval_sample_weight : list of Dask Array or Dask Series, or None, optional (default=None)
445
        Weights for each validation set in eval_set. Weights should be non-negative.
446
447
    eval_class_weight : list of dict or str, or None, optional (default=None)
        Class weights, one dict or str for each validation set in eval_set.
448
    eval_init_score : list of Dask Array, Dask Series or Dask DataFrame (for multi-class task), or None, optional (default=None)
449
        Initial model score for each validation set in eval_set.
450
    eval_group : list of Dask Array or Dask Series, or None, optional (default=None)
451
        Group/query for each validation set in eval_set.
452
453
    eval_metric : str, callable, list or None, optional (default=None)
        If str, it should be a built-in evaluation metric to use.
454
455
456
457
        If callable, it should be a custom evaluation metric, see note below for more details.
        If list, it can be a list of built-in metrics, a list of custom evaluation metrics, or a mix of both.
        In either case, the ``metric`` from the Dask model parameters (or inferred from the objective) will be evaluated and used as well.
        Default: 'l2' for DaskLGBMRegressor, 'binary(multi)_logloss' for DaskLGBMClassifier, 'ndcg' for DaskLGBMRanker.
458
    eval_at : list or tuple of int, optional (default=None)
459
        The evaluation positions of the specified ranking metric.
460
461
462
463
464
465
466
    **kwargs
        Other parameters passed to ``fit`` method of the local underlying model.

    Returns
    -------
    model : lightgbm.LGBMClassifier, lightgbm.LGBMRegressor, or lightgbm.LGBMRanker class
        Returns fitted underlying model.
467
468
469
470
471
472
473
474
475
476
477
478
479
480
481
482
483
484
485
486
487
488
489
490
491
492
493
494
495

    Note
    ----

    This method handles setting up the following network parameters based on information
    about the Dask cluster referenced by ``client``.

    * ``local_listen_port``: port that each LightGBM worker opens a listening socket on,
            to accept connections from other workers. This can differ from LightGBM worker
            to LightGBM worker, but does not have to.
    * ``machines``: a comma-delimited list of all workers in the cluster, in the
            form ``ip:port,ip:port``. If running multiple Dask workers on the same host, use different
            ports for each worker. For example, for ``LocalCluster(n_workers=3)``, you might
            pass ``"127.0.0.1:12400,127.0.0.1:12401,127.0.0.1:12402"``.
    * ``num_machines``: number of LightGBM workers.
    * ``timeout``: time in minutes to wait before closing unused sockets.

    The default behavior of this function is to generate ``machines`` from the list of
    Dask workers which hold some piece of the training data, and to search for an open
    port on each worker to be used as ``local_listen_port``.

    If ``machines`` is provided explicitly in ``params``, this function uses the hosts
    and ports in that list directly, and does not do any searching. This means that if
    any of the Dask workers are missing from the list or any of those ports are not free
    when training starts, training will fail.

    If ``local_listen_port`` is provided in ``params`` and ``machines`` is not, this function
    constructs ``machines`` from the list of Dask workers which hold some piece of the
    training data, assuming that each one will use the same ``local_listen_port``.
496
    """

    # evals_set will to be re-constructed into smaller lists of (X, y) tuples, where
    # X and y are each delayed sub-lists of original eval dask Collections.
    if eval_set:
        # find maximum number of parts in an individual eval set so that we can
        # pad eval sets when they come in different sizes.
        n_largest_eval_parts = max(x[0].npartitions for x in eval_set)

        eval_sets = defaultdict(list)
        if eval_sample_weight:
            eval_sample_weights = defaultdict(list)
        if eval_group:
            eval_groups = defaultdict(list)
        if eval_init_score:
            eval_init_scores = defaultdict(list)

        for i, (X_eval, y_eval) in enumerate(eval_set):
            n_this_eval_parts = X_eval.npartitions

            # when individual eval set is equivalent to training data, skip recomputing parts.
            if X_eval is data and y_eval is label:
                for parts_idx in range(n_parts):
                    eval_sets[parts_idx].append(_DatasetNames.TRAINSET)
            else:
                eval_x_parts = _split_to_parts(data=X_eval, is_matrix=True)
                eval_y_parts = _split_to_parts(data=y_eval, is_matrix=False)
                for j in range(n_largest_eval_parts):
                    parts_idx = j % n_parts

                    # add None-padding for individual eval_set member if it is smaller than the largest member.
                    if j < n_this_eval_parts:
                        x_e = eval_x_parts[j]
                        y_e = eval_y_parts[j]
                    else:
                        x_e = None
                        y_e = None

                    if j < n_parts:
                        # first time a chunk of this eval set is added to this part.
                        eval_sets[parts_idx].append(([x_e], [y_e]))
                    else:
                        # append additional chunks of this eval set to this part.
                        eval_sets[parts_idx][-1][0].append(x_e)
                        eval_sets[parts_idx][-1][1].append(y_e)

            if eval_sample_weight:
                if eval_sample_weight[i] is sample_weight:
                    for parts_idx in range(n_parts):
                        eval_sample_weights[parts_idx].append(_DatasetNames.SAMPLE_WEIGHT)
                else:
                    eval_w_parts = _split_to_parts(data=eval_sample_weight[i], is_matrix=False)

                    # ensure that all evaluation parts map uniquely to one part.
                    for j in range(n_largest_eval_parts):
                        if j < n_this_eval_parts:
                            w_e = eval_w_parts[j]
                        else:
                            w_e = None

                        parts_idx = j % n_parts
                        if j < n_parts:
                            eval_sample_weights[parts_idx].append([w_e])
                        else:
                            eval_sample_weights[parts_idx][-1].append(w_e)

            if eval_init_score:
                if eval_init_score[i] is init_score:
                    for parts_idx in range(n_parts):
                        eval_init_scores[parts_idx].append(_DatasetNames.INIT_SCORE)
                else:
                    eval_init_score_parts = _split_to_parts(data=eval_init_score[i], is_matrix=False)
                    for j in range(n_largest_eval_parts):
                        if j < n_this_eval_parts:
                            init_score_e = eval_init_score_parts[j]
                        else:
                            init_score_e = None

                        parts_idx = j % n_parts
                        if j < n_parts:
                            eval_init_scores[parts_idx].append([init_score_e])
                        else:
                            eval_init_scores[parts_idx][-1].append(init_score_e)

            if eval_group:
                if eval_group[i] is group:
                    for parts_idx in range(n_parts):
                        eval_groups[parts_idx].append(_DatasetNames.GROUP)
                else:
                    eval_g_parts = _split_to_parts(data=eval_group[i], is_matrix=False)
                    for j in range(n_largest_eval_parts):
                        if j < n_this_eval_parts:
                            g_e = eval_g_parts[j]
                        else:
                            g_e = None

                        parts_idx = j % n_parts
                        if j < n_parts:
                            eval_groups[parts_idx].append([g_e])
                        else:
                            eval_groups[parts_idx][-1].append(g_e)

        # assign sub-eval_set components to worker parts.
        for parts_idx, e_set in eval_sets.items():
            parts[parts_idx]['eval_set'] = e_set
            if eval_sample_weight:
                parts[parts_idx]['eval_sample_weight'] = eval_sample_weights[parts_idx]
            if eval_init_score:
                parts[parts_idx]['eval_init_score'] = eval_init_scores[parts_idx]
            if eval_group:
                parts[parts_idx]['eval_group'] = eval_groups[parts_idx]
